I ka ʻōnaehana pākaukau lithium-ion pāʻoihana o kēia manawa, ʻo ka mea palena ʻo ia ka conductivity uila.ʻO ka mea nui, ʻo ka lawa ʻole o ka conductivity o ka mea electrode maikaʻi e kaupalena pono i ka hana o ka hopena electrochemical.Pono e hoʻohui i kahi mea hana conductive kūpono e hoʻonui ai i ka conductivity o ka mea a kūkulu i ka pūnaewele conductive e hāʻawi i kahi ala wikiwiki no ka lawe ʻana i nā electron a hōʻoia i ka hoʻohana pono ʻana o ka mea hana.No laila, ʻo ka mea hana conductive he mea pono ʻole i ka pā lithium ion e pili ana i ka mea hana.

ʻO ka hana o kahi mea hana conductive e hilinaʻi nui i ke ʻano o nā mea hana a me nā ʻano e pili ana me ka mea hana.ʻO nā mea hoʻohana maʻamau lithium ion conductive agents i kēia mau hiʻohiʻona:

(1) ʻEleʻele kalapona: Hōʻike ʻia ke ʻano o ke kalapona ʻeleʻele e ke kiʻekiʻe o ka hui ʻana o nā ʻāpana kalapona ʻeleʻele i loko o ke kaulahao a i ʻole ke ʻano hua waina.ʻO nā ʻāpana maikaʻi, ke kaulahao pūnaewele paʻa paʻa, ka ʻāpana kikoʻī kikoʻī nui, a me ka nui o ka ʻāpana, he mea maikaʻi ia e hana i ke kaulahao conductive i loko o ka electrode.Ma ke ʻano he ʻelele o nā mea hoʻokele maʻamau, ʻo ka ʻeleʻele kalapona i kēia manawa ka mea hoʻohana nui loa.ʻO ka hemahema ʻo ia ke kiʻekiʻe o ke kumukūʻai a paʻakikī ke hoʻopuehu.

(2)graphite: Hōʻike ʻia ka graphite conductive e ka nui o ka nui kokoke i ka nui o nā mea hana maikaʻi a maikaʻi ʻole, kahi ʻili kūpono kūpono, a me ka conductivity uila maikaʻi.Hoʻohana ia ma ke ʻano he node o ka pūnaewele conductive i ka pākaukau, a i ka electrode maikaʻi ʻole, ʻaʻole hiki iā ia ke hoʻomaikaʻi wale i ka conductivity, akā i ka hiki.

(3) P-Li: Hōʻike ʻia ʻo Super P-Li e ka liʻiliʻi liʻiliʻi, e like me ke kalapona kalapona ʻeleʻele, akā ʻoi aku ka liʻiliʻi o ka ʻili, ʻoi aku ka maikaʻi o ka hoʻokumu ʻana i kahi pūnaewele conductive.ʻO ka hemahema, he paʻakikī ke hoʻopuehu.

(4)Nanotubes kalapona(CNTs): ʻO nā CNT nā mea hoʻokele i puka mai i nā makahiki i hala iho nei.Loaʻa iā lākou ke anawaena ma kahi o 5nm a me ka lōʻihi o 10-20um.ʻAʻole hiki iā lākou ke hana wale ma ke ʻano he "uwea" i nā ʻoihana conductive, akā loaʻa pū kekahi i ka hopena electrode layer pālua e hāʻawi i ka pāʻani i nā hiʻohiʻona kiʻekiʻe o nā supercapacitors.ʻO kāna conductivity thermal maikaʻi he mea kūpono hoʻi i ka hoʻokuʻu ʻana i ka wela i ka wā o ka hoʻopiʻi ʻana a me ka hoʻokuʻu ʻana, e hōʻemi i ka polarization pākaukau, hoʻomaikaʻi i ka hana kiʻekiʻe a me ka haʻahaʻa haʻahaʻa o ka pākaukau, a hoʻonui i ke ola pākaukau.

Ma ke ʻano he alakaʻi alakaʻi, hiki ke hoʻohana ʻia nā CNT i hui pū me nā mea electrode maikaʻi e hoʻomaikaʻi ai i ka hiki, ka helu, a me ka hana pōʻai o nā mea / pā.ʻO nā mea electrode maikaʻi e hiki ke hoʻohana ʻia: LiCoO2, LiMn2O4, LiFePO4, polymer positive electrode, Li3V2(PO4)3, manganese oxide, a me nā mea like.

Ke hoʻohālikelike ʻia me nā mea hana conductive maʻamau, ʻoi aku ka maikaʻi o nā nanotubes carbon e like me nā mea hoʻokele maikaʻi a maikaʻi ʻole no nā pākahi lithium ion.He kiʻekiʻe ka conductivity uila o Carbon nanotubes.Eia hou, CNTs nui hiʻona lākiō, a me ka haʻahaʻa hoʻohui nui hiki ke hoʻokō i ka percolation paepae e like me 'ē aʻe additives (mālama 'ana i ka mamao o electrons i loko o ka hui 'ole ka neʻeʻana kūloko).No ka mea hiki i ka carbon nanotubes ke hoʻokumu i kahi pūnaewele lawe electron maikaʻi loa, hiki ke loaʻa kahi waiwai conductivity e like me ka mea hoʻohui spherical particle me ka 0.2 wt% wale nō o SWCNTs.

(5)GrapheneHe ʻano hou ia o nā mea kalapona planar hikiwawe ʻelua ʻāpana me ka hoʻokele uila a me ka wela.Hāʻawi ka hale i ka ʻāpana pepa graphene e hoʻopili i nā ʻāpana mea hana, a hāʻawi i kahi helu nui o nā wahi hoʻopili conductive no ka maikaʻi a me ka maikaʻi ʻole o ka electrode mea ʻeleʻele, i hiki ai i nā electrons ke alakaʻi ʻia i kahi ākea ʻelua e hana i kahi. ʻupena conductive wahi nui.No laila ua manaʻo ʻia ʻo ia ka mea hana conductive kūpono i kēia manawa.

ʻO ke kalaponaʻeleʻele a me ka mea hana i ke kiko kiko, a hiki ke komo i loko o nā'āpana o ka mea hana e hoʻonui piha i ka ratio hoʻohana o nā mea hana.Ke kalapona nanotubes aia ma ke kiko laina pili, a hiki ke interspersed ma waena o nā mea hana e hana i ka hoʻolālā pūnaewele, ʻaʻole ia e hoʻonui wale i ka conductivity, I ka manawa like, hiki iā ia ke hana ma ke ʻano he ʻāpana hoʻopaʻa ʻana, a me ke ʻano pili o graphene. ʻo ia ka hoʻopili ʻana i ka maka, hiki ke hoʻopili i ka ʻili o ka mea ʻeleu e hana i kahi ʻāpana conductive pūnaewele nui e like me ke kino nui, akā paʻakikī ke uhi piha i ka mea hana.ʻOiai inā e hoʻonui mau ʻia ka nui o ka graphene i hoʻohui ʻia, paʻakikī ke hoʻohana piha i ka mea hana, a hoʻopuehu i nā liona Li a hoʻopau i ka hana electrode.No laila, he ʻano hoʻohui maikaʻi kēia mau mea ʻekolu.ʻO ka hui ʻana i ke kalapona ʻeleʻele a i ʻole carbon nanotubes me ka graphene e kūkulu i kahi ʻoihana conductive piha loa hiki ke hoʻomaikaʻi hou i ka hana holoʻokoʻa o ka electrode.

Eia kekahi, mai ka hiʻohiʻona o ka graphene, ʻokoʻa ka hana o ka graphene mai nā ʻano hoʻomākaukau like ʻole, ma ke ʻano o ka hoʻemi ʻana, ka nui o ka lau a me ka ratio o ka ʻeleʻele kalapona, ka dispersibility, a me ka mānoanoa o ka electrode e pili ana i nā ʻano. o nā mea hana conductive nui loa.Ma waena o lākou, no ka mea, ʻo ka hana o ka mea hoʻokele conductive ke kūkulu ʻana i kahi pūnaewele conductive no ka lawe ʻana i nā electron, inā ʻaʻole i hoʻopuehu maikaʻi ʻia ka mea hoʻokele ponoʻī, paʻakikī ke kūkulu ʻana i kahi pūnaewele conductive kūpono.Hoʻohālikelike ʻia me ka mea hoʻokele kalapona ʻeleʻele maʻamau, loaʻa i ka graphene kahi ʻāpana kikoʻī kiʻekiʻe kiʻekiʻe, a ʻo ka hopena conjugate π-π e maʻalahi ka hoʻohui ʻana i nā noi kūpono.No laila, pehea e hana ai i ka graphene i kahi ʻōnaehana hoʻopuehu maikaʻi a hoʻohana piha i kāna hana maikaʻi loa he pilikia koʻikoʻi e pono e hoʻoponopono ʻia i ka hoʻohana ākea o ka graphene.
